Fold-Stack: A Sovereign Development Environment

Fold-Stack is a self-hosted, sovereign development environment designed for fieldcraft, collaboration, and resilient data management. It integrates a suite of tools for blogging, version control, note-taking, document editing, file storage, and replication across cloud services. This stack is built with Docker Compose for easy deployment and management.

📜 Project Overview

Fold-Stack provides a modular, self-contained environment for:

  • Blogging: Ghost for publishing content.
  • Version Control: Forgejo for Git repository management.
  • Decentralized Collaboration: Radicle for peer-to-peer version control.
  • Document Conversion: Pandoc for converting documents (e.g., Markdown to PDF).
  • Email Testing: MailHog for capturing and testing emails.
  • Note-Taking: Trilium for hierarchical note management.
  • Collaborative Editing: HedgeDoc for real-time Markdown collaboration.
  • File Storage: Nextcloud for file storage and sharing.
  • Data Replication: Rclone for syncing data to Google Drive, Internet Archive, and Web3.storage.
  • Document Compilation: Typst for fast, modern document creation.
  • LaTeX Collaboration: Overleaf CE for collaborative LaTeX editing.
  • Git Mirroring: Git-Sync Mirror Agent for syncing Git repositories to multiple remotes.

The stack is designed to be lightweight by default, with resource-heavy services (like Overleaf CE) toggleable to optimize performance.

3. Configure Rclone for Data Replication

Fold-Stack uses Rclone to replicate data to Google Drive, Internet Archive, and Web3.storage. You need to configure the remotes:

  1. Run the Rclone configuration wizard:

    rclone config
    
  2. Add the following remotes:

    • Google Drive (gdrive):
      • Choose n (new remote).
      • Name: gdrive
      • Type: drive (Google Drive).
      • Client ID/Secret: Leave blank.
      • Scope: drive (full access, option 1).
      • Root Folder ID: Leave blank.
      • Service Account File: Leave blank.
      • Edit Advanced Config: n.
      • Auto Config: y (follow the browser prompt to authenticate).
      • Configure as a Shared Drive: n.
    • Internet Archive (ia):
      • Choose n (new remote).
      • Name: ia
      • Type: internetarchive.
      • Access Key ID: Your Internet Archive access key (get from archive.org account settings).
      • Secret Access Key: Your Internet Archive secret key.
      • Edit Advanced Config: n.
    • Web3.storage (web3):
      • Choose n (new remote).
      • Name: web3
      • Type: ipfs.
      • Host: api.web3.storage.
      • API Token: Your Web3.storage API token (get from web3.storage).
      • Edit Advanced Config: n.
  3. Copy the Rclone configuration to the project:

    mkdir -p ./config/rclone
    cp ~/.config/rclone/rclone.conf ./config/rclone/rclone.conf
    chmod 600 ./config/rclone/rclone.conf
    
  4. Verify the remotes:

    rclone listremotes --config ./config/rclone/rclone.conf
    

    You should see: gdrive:, ia:, nextcloud:, web3:.

4. Configure Git-Sync Mirror Agent

The Git-Sync Mirror Agent syncs a local Git repository to multiple remotes (GitHub, Forgejo, Radicle, Internet Archive, and optionally Web3.storage).

  1. Initialize a Local Repository:

    mkdir -p volumes/repos
    cd volumes/repos
    git init
    echo "# Test Repo" > README.md
    git add .
    git commit -m "Initial commit"
    git branch -M main
    
  2. Set Up SSH Keys for GitHub and Forgejo:

    • Generate SSH keys if you dont already have them:
      ssh-keygen -t ed25519 -C "your_email@example.com" -f ~/.ssh/github_key
      ssh-keygen -t ed25519 -C "your_email@example.com" -f ~/.ssh/forgejo_key
      
    • Add the public keys to GitHub and Forgejo:
    • Copy the private keys to the git-sync secrets directory:
      cp ~/.ssh/github_key config/git-sync/secrets/github.key
      cp ~/.ssh/forgejo_key config/git-sync/secrets/forgejo.key
      chmod 600 config/git-sync/secrets/github.key config/git-sync/secrets/forgejo.key
      
  3. Configure Remotes: Edit config/git-sync/remotes.conf to match your repository URLs:

    github|git|git@github.com:mrhavens/mirror-repo.git|1
    forgejo|git|git@localhost:2222/mrhavens/mirror-repo.git|1
    radicle|radicle|radicle://mrhavens/mirror-repo|1
    ia|rclone|ia:fold-stack-git-mirror|1
    web3|rclone|web3:fold-stack-git-mirror|0

9. Rclone: Verify Data Replication

Rclone automatically syncs data from the volumes directory to remote services:

  • Google Drive: Syncs ./volumes/scrolls and ./volumes/hedgedoc/uploads to fold-stack/scrolls and fold-stack/hedgedoc_uploads.
  • Internet Archive: Syncs .scroll, .seal, .typ, and .tex files from ./volumes/scrolls to fold-stack-scrolls.
  • Web3.storage: Syncs ./volumes/trilium-backup to fold-stack-trilium.
  1. Add a test file to trigger a sync:
    echo "Test file" > ./volumes/scrolls/test-rclone.scroll
    
  2. Monitor Rclone logs:
    docker logs rclone_dev --follow
    
  3. Verify the file appears on:
    • Google Drive: Check fold-stack/scrolls.
    • Internet Archive: Check fold-stack-scrolls.

12. Git-Sync: Mirror a Git Repository

The Git-Sync Mirror Agent watches the local repository at ./volumes/repos and syncs changes to GitHub, Forgejo, Radicle, Internet Archive, and optionally Web3.storage.

  1. Add a Commit to the Local Repository:

    cd volumes/repos
    echo "Change 1" >> README.md
    git add .
    git commit -m "Change 1"
    
  2. Manually Push to All Remotes: To trigger a manual sync to all configured remotes, run:

    ./scripts/manual-push-git-sync.sh
    

    This script pushes the latest changes to all enabled remotes immediately, bypassing the automated sync interval.

  3. Monitor Git-Sync Logs:

    docker logs git_sync_dev --follow
    

    You should see the sync process for each configured remote.

  4. Verify Sync:

    • GitHub: Check your GitHub repository (`mrhavens/mirror-repo`).
    • Forgejo: Check `http://localhost:3000/mrhavens/mirror-repo`.
    • Internet Archive: Check `fold-stack-git-mirror` for Git bundles.
    • Web3.storage: Enable in `remotes.conf` and check `fold-stack-git-mirror`.

Configuration:

  • Edit `config/git-sync/.env` to adjust settings:
    SYNC_INTERVAL=300  # Sync check interval in seconds
    PUSH_MODE=push     # "push" for git push, "bundle" for git bundle
    SIGN_COMMITS=false # Set to true to enable commit signing (requires GPG)
    LOG_LEVEL=INFO     # Log verbosity (INFO, ERROR)
    RETRY_MAX=3        # Max retry attempts for failed syncs
    RETRY_BACKOFF=5    # Base backoff time in seconds for retries
    

Logs:

  • Logs are stored in `./volumes/logs` with filenames like `sync-.log` or `manual-push-.log`.

Diagnostics:

  • Run the diagnostic script to troubleshoot issues:
    ./scripts/diagnose-git-sync.sh
    
    This script checks the container status, configuration files, SSH keys, remote connectivity, logs, and volumes, providing detailed error messages and fixes.

Sync Report:

  • Generate a report to see the latest sync activity for each remote:
    ./scripts/report-git-sync.sh
    
    This report shows the latest commit in the local repository, the last successful sync for each remote (with timestamp and commit/bundle details), and any recent failed sync attempts.

🛠️ Troubleshooting

General Issues

  • Container Not Running: Check logs for the specific container:
    docker logs <container_name>
    
    Restart the stack:
    ./scripts/down-dev.sh && ./scripts/up-dev.sh
    
  • Port Conflicts: Check for port conflicts:
    netstat -tuln | grep <port>
    
    Stop conflicting processes or change the port in `docker-compose.dev.yml`.

Rclone Issues

  • Sync Not Working: Verify Rclone remotes:
    rclone listremotes --config ./config/rclone/rclone.conf
    
    Reconfigure if needed:
    rclone config
    
  • Permission Issues: Fix volume permissions:
    chmod -R 775 ./volumes
    chown -R 1000:1000 ./volumes
    

Overleaf CE Issues

  • Startup Errors: Check logs for Overleaf, MongoDB, and Redis:
    docker logs overleaf_dev
    docker logs overleaf_mongo_dev
    docker logs overleaf_redis_dev
    
    Ensure MongoDB and Redis are healthy before Overleaf starts (handled by `depends_on` in `docker-compose.dev.yml`).

Git-Sync Issues

  • Sync Fails: Run diagnostics:
    ./scripts/diagnose-git-sync.sh
    
    Ensure SSH keys are correctly set up and remotes are accessible.
  • Radicle Not Syncing: Radicle sync is a placeholder. Implement the `rad` CLI in `entrypoint.sh` if needed.
  • Check Sync Status: Generate a sync report:
    ./scripts/report-git-sync.sh
